NPC’s high quality,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) Certificate of Applied Science option prepares you to take the Arizona LPN examination and excel in the exciting field of vocational nursing. Through hands-on experiences working in the classroom, clinicals and the community, you will receive the education you need to achieve your career goals in the healing profession.

- Have the option to choose to continue your studies in NPC's nursing program for a second year to become a Registered Nurse by earning an Associate of Applied Science (AAS) degree.
Students wanting to earn a LPN certificate must apply to be admitted into NPC's Registered Nurse AAS degree program. BEFORE being accepted, you must complete certain prerequisite courses (see entry requirements below). Admission to NPC does NOT guarantee admission to the nursing program.
